#2a4188 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a4188 is composed of 16.5% red, 25.5%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 225.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 34.9%. #2a4188 color hex could be obtained by blending #5482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#2a4188 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#2a4188 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a4188 has RGB values of R:42, G:65,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2769288.

Shades and Tints of #2a4188
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a4188
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53565f is the less saturated color, while #012cb1 is the most saturated one.
